[Yorba Linda] – El Monte’s offense, with just 29 plays on the night, rushed for 463 yards in a 57-14 victory over Fairmount Prep in the CIF quarterfinals Friday night at Yorba Linda High School.
Abel Cueva has just four carries on the night but made the most of them finding the end zone three times and 163 yards.
El Monte had two other 100 yard rushers on the night. Davon Booth had 5 carries for 109 yards and a score, while Ben Owsley had 4 touches for 112 yards and 2 trips to paydirt.
Carlos Zuira and Nathan Velasquez also found the end zone for the Lions.
Fairmount Prep fought hard with just 19 players on the roster. Brian Wright picked up his quarterbacks fumble and returned it for a touchdown midway through the first quarter. In the fourth quarter Kyle Karam found Jason Terry for a 9-yard score.
El Monte (11-1) advances to the semi finals for the first time since 1979 and will face Adelanto (11-1) at home.
